Overview
The Altera 5SGSED8K2F40I3G is a Stratix V GS Field Programmable Gate Array (FPGA) featuring 696 I/Os and housed in a 1517-BBGA/FCBGA package. It contains 695,000 logic elements, 262,400 Adaptive Logic Modules (ALMs), and 51,200,000 total RAM bits. The device operates on a supply voltage of 0.82V to 0.88V and supports a maximum data rate of 14.1 Gb/s via 36 transceivers. It functions within a junction temperature range of -40°C to 100°C.

Procurement Notes
Verify the specific suffix 'I3G' against official Altera documentation to confirm the industrial temperature grade and RoHS compliance status. Confirm current production lifecycle status as some Stratix V variants may be discontinued or subject to last-time buy notices. Ensure compatibility with Quartus Prime software versions supporting the Stratix V family before procurement.
Selection Notes
Select this model for designs requiring high-density logic combined with significant embedded memory resources. The 14.1 Gb/s transceiver capability makes it suitable for high-bandwidth serial applications. Compare against the 5SGXEA series if higher performance or different power characteristics are required, noting that the GS variant focuses on cost-effective density.
Part Context
This component belongs to the Altera Stratix V GS family, designed for high-volume, cost-sensitive applications compared to the GX or GT families. It shares the same 1517-pin footprint as other devices in the 5SGS... and 5SGX... series, facilitating potential board-level pin compatibility within the same package type.
